Alex Cameron’s new album is called “Late to Set.” “Late to Set” was born of 9 forgotten long form screenplays written between the year 2022 and 2025. Rejected by the studios, lost to the LA wildfires, the charred remains fragmented and saved in songs of deep confusion and regret.


III.

“Late to Set” is Al’s fifth album. Production credits include Mark Perkins, Zach Dawes and Maxim Ludwig among others.

I once read a book called Demonic Males: Apes and the Origins of Human Violence by Dale Peterson and Richard Wrangham. It’s about the differences between bonobos and chimpanzees. If you throw an empty cardboard box into a room full of bonobos, they’ll all fuck each other silly and generously share the box. If you throw that same box into a room full of chimps, they’ll kill and kill and kill until the last one gets the box. We share 99% of our DNA with both.
